West Brom head coach Roberto Di Matteo does not want to lose Robert Koren in the January transfer window but he understands the frustrations aired by the midfielder earlier this week.
The Slovenia captain (pictured) was quoted as telling a news agency in his homeland that he plans to leave the club in the new year due a lack of opportunity this season in his favoured central midfield role.
A number of clubs have already been linked with a move for the disillusioned 29-year-old and Di Matteo plans to hold talks will him in the near future to discuss a positive resolution.
He told the club website: "When I moved here we had a lot of central midfield players, quite a lot of them with similar ability. That made things more difficult for everybody to get into the team.
"I've had a chat with Roko (Koren) and he wants to play. He is at an age where he doesn't want to be on the bench and he is also the captain of his national team. I understand his frustration and his needs.
"But from my point of view, I also need to have a look at what is the best possible team to win on any given day. I think he is a very good footballer and I wouldn't want to lose him, but we will have to sit down and see what the best solution is for both us and him."
